
Dan had not prepared a sermon, but Scripture teaches us to be ready in season and out of season. We were giving away reader's Bibles (NIrV), Dan did not have the Bible he uses to preach from, but he knows Romans Road by heart. So, with FoS Pub Evangelist Bart Helmbreck on the guitar, and with Kim singing, and with song sheets from Bart's car, a service was born at 1:00 Saturday afternoon in Carver Park with 12-15 people in attendance. Many asked if services would continue next week at 1 pm, and promised to be back.
